As tiie ech •■>! his hail only a little over 8 mom ha to prepare for the examination ho result gamed is ve y aaiist iCtnry inileed Reailinr. Intelligent ami generally ao curate. The language of the reading books is tnleralily well understood. Spelling.—Good, Wiii.ing. Excellent. anil mat of the exern se-honks are models of neatness Ari'hmiiio. - The wo k in the 3rd, 4Mi and stn Standards satUfac ory. In the test good. . Grammar -Tolerably well known in all the Standards learning the subj iots. Geography. -Very wed known by most of the pupils. History —Fairly known. A satisfactory amount of work has been done in o' ject lessons, but singlin' drawing, and elementaly science are not taken up. Most of the sewing is very creditable and all the girls are engaged upon useful garm The children are well behaved and the tone of the school appears to bo pood. The records are fully mule up and very neatly fcept. The schoolroom is dean, A tan* and a fence round the school property are much seeded.
